Implement KVM_IA64_VCPU_[GS]ET_STACK ioctl calls. This is required
for live migrations.
Patch is based on previous implementation that was part of old
GET/SET_REGS ioctl calls.
Signed-off-by: Jes Sorensen <jes@sgi.com>
---
arch/ia64/include/asm/kvm.h | 7 ++
arch/ia64/include/asm/kvm_host.h | 6 ++
arch/ia64/kvm/kvm-ia64.c | 92 +++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++--
include/linux/kvm.h | 3 +
4 files changed, 104 insertions(+), 4 deletions(-)
Index: kvm/arch/ia64/include/asm/kvm.h
===================================================================
--- kvm.orig/arch/ia64/include/asm/kvm.h
+++ kvm/arch/ia64/include/asm/kvm.h
@@ -210,6 +210,13 @@
struct kvm_fpu {
};
+#define KVM_IA64_VCPU_STACK_SHIFT 16
+#define KVM_IA64_VCPU_STACK_SIZE (1UL << KVM_IA64_VCPU_STACK_SHIFT)
+
+struct kvm_ia64_vcpu_stack {
+ unsigned char stack[KVM_IA64_VCPU_STACK_SIZE];
+};
+
struct kvm_debug_exit_arch {
};
Index: kvm/arch/ia64/include/asm/kvm_host.h
===================================================================
--- kvm.orig/arch/ia64/include/asm/kvm_host.h
+++ kvm/arch/ia64/include/asm/kvm_host.h
@@ -112,7 +112,11 @@
#define VCPU_STRUCT_SHIFT 16
#define VCPU_STRUCT_SIZE (__IA64_UL_CONST(1) << VCPU_STRUCT_SHIFT)
-#define KVM_STK_OFFSET VCPU_STRUCT_SIZE
+/*
+ * This must match KVM_IA64_VCPU_STACK_{SHIFT,SIZE} arch/ia64/include/asm/kvm.h
+ */
+#define KVM_STK_SHIFT 16
+#define KVM_STK_OFFSET (__IA64_UL_CONST(1)<< KVM_STK_SHIFT)
#define KVM_VM_STRUCT_SHIFT 19
#define KVM_VM_STRUCT_SIZE (__IA64_UL_CONST(1) << KVM_VM_STRUCT_SHIFT)
Index: kvm/arch/ia64/kvm/kvm-ia64.c
===================================================================
--- kvm.orig/arch/ia64/kvm/kvm-ia64.c
+++ kvm/arch/ia64/kvm/kvm-ia64.c
@@ -1416,6 +1416,23 @@
return 0;
}
+int kvm_arch_vcpu_ioctl_get_stack(struct kvm_vcpu *vcpu,
+ struct kvm_ia64_vcpu_stack *stack)
+{
+ memcpy(stack, vcpu, sizeof(struct kvm_ia64_vcpu_stack));
+ return 0;
+}
+
+int kvm_arch_vcpu_ioctl_set_stack(struct kvm_vcpu *vcpu,
+ struct kvm_ia64_vcpu_stack *stack)
+{
+ memcpy(vcpu + 1, &stack->stack[0] + sizeof(struct kvm_vcpu),
+ sizeof(struct kvm_ia64_vcpu_stack) - sizeof(struct kvm_vcpu));
+
+ vcpu->arch.exit_data = ((struct kvm_vcpu *)stack)->arch.exit_data;
+ return 0;
+}
+
void kvm_arch_vcpu_uninit(struct kvm_vcpu *vcpu)
{
@@ -1425,9 +1442,78 @@
long kvm_arch_vcpu_ioctl(struct file *filp,
- unsigned int ioctl, unsigned long arg)
+ unsigned int ioctl, unsigned long arg)
{
- return -EINVAL;
+ struct kvm_vcpu *vcpu = filp->private_data;
+ void __user *argp = (void __user *)arg;
+ struct kvm_ia64_vcpu_stack *stack = NULL;
+ long r;
+
+ switch (ioctl) {
+ case KVM_IA64_VCPU_GET_STACK: {
+ struct kvm_ia64_vcpu_stack __user *user_stack;
+ void __user *first_p = argp;
+
+ r = -EFAULT;
+ if (copy_from_user(&user_stack, first_p, sizeof(void *)))
+ goto out;
+
+ if (!access_ok(VERIFY_WRITE, user_stack,
+ sizeof(struct kvm_ia64_vcpu_stack))) {
+ printk(KERN_INFO "KVM_IA64_VCPU_GET_STACK: "
+ "Illegal user destination address for stack\n");
+ goto out;
+ }
+ stack = kzalloc(sizeof(struct kvm_ia64_vcpu_stack), GFP_KERNEL);
+ if (!stack) {
+ r = -ENOMEM;
+ goto out;
+ }
+
+ r = kvm_arch_vcpu_ioctl_get_stack(vcpu, stack);
+ if (r)
+ goto out;
+
+ if (copy_to_user(user_stack, stack,
+ sizeof(struct kvm_ia64_vcpu_stack)))
+ goto out;
+
+ break;
+ }
+ case KVM_IA64_VCPU_SET_STACK: {
+ struct kvm_ia64_vcpu_stack __user *user_stack;
+ void __user *first_p = argp;
+
+ r = -EFAULT;
+ if (copy_from_user(&user_stack, first_p, sizeof(void *)))
+ goto out;
+
+ if (!access_ok(VERIFY_READ, user_stack,
+ sizeof(struct kvm_ia64_vcpu_stack))) {
+ printk(KERN_INFO "KVM_IA64_VCPU_SET_STACK: "
+ "Illegal user address for stack\n");
+ goto out;
+ }
+ stack = kmalloc(sizeof(struct kvm_ia64_vcpu_stack), GFP_KERNEL);
+ if (!stack) {
+ r = -ENOMEM;
+ goto out;
+ }
+ if (copy_from_user(stack, user_stack,
+ sizeof(struct kvm_ia64_vcpu_stack)))
+ goto out;
+
+ r = kvm_arch_vcpu_ioctl_set_stack(vcpu, stack);
+ break;
+ }
+
+ default:
+ r = -EINVAL;
+ }
+
+out:
+ kfree(stack);
+ return r;
}
int kvm_arch_set_memory_region(struct kvm *kvm,
@@ -1467,7 +1553,7 @@
}
long kvm_arch_dev_ioctl(struct file *filp,
- unsigned int ioctl, unsigned long arg)
+ unsigned int ioctl, unsigned long arg)
{
return -EINVAL;
}
Index: kvm/include/linux/kvm.h
===================================================================
--- kvm.orig/include/linux/kvm.h
+++ kvm/include/linux/kvm.h
@@ -489,6 +489,9 @@
#define __KVM_DEPRECATED_DEBUG_GUEST _IOW(KVMIO, 0x87, struct kvm_debug_guest)
+#define KVM_IA64_VCPU_GET_STACK _IOR(KVMIO, 0x9a, void *)
+#define KVM_IA64_VCPU_SET_STACK _IOW(KVMIO, 0x9b, void *)
+
#define KVM_TRC_INJ_VIRQ (KVM_TRC_HANDLER + 0x02)
#define KVM_TRC_REDELIVER_EVT (KVM_TRC_HANDLER + 0x03)
#define KVM_TRC_PEND_INTR (KVM_TRC_HANDLER + 0x04)
